
Vue
文章平均质量分 73
Vue相关文章
_月半小夜曲
拒绝粘贴复制,全部原创手敲,参考文章也会在文章末尾留下参考链接,喜欢的朋友可以关注我的个人微信公众号"前端V",感谢支持!!!!
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
基于vue-router的matched实现面包屑功能
如上图所示,就是常见的面包屑效果,面包屑的内容一般来说,具有一定的层级关系,就以上图为例,首先是进入首页,然后点击左侧导航,进入活动管理下的活动列表页面,然后点击某一条数据,进入活动详情页面 这正好与vue-router的mached属性所获取的结果有着相似的原理,所以可以基于此来实现面包屑效果! 这里我使用了elementui的面包屑组件和导航菜单组件,先贴出最后的效果图: 路由配置 项目结构: 侧边导航栏是首页、电子数码、服装鞋帽页面都会显示的,所以我创建了一个layout组件,将这三个路由的co.原创 2021-09-25 21:55:01 · 2710 阅读 · 0 评论 -
Vue添加环境/多环境
注:本篇博客是基于vue-cli 2.9.6版本 vue-cli默认自带production和development两种开发环境,但是在实际工作中一般还有测试环境、预发布环境等,可以修改package.json添加新的打包命令,可以从而根据不同环境自动切换接口的BASE_URL,所以本篇文章将以添加测试环境为例,演示如何添加环境 新增新环境变量文件 项目的环境变量文件都在项目根目录下的config文件夹下,默认有两种环境变量文件,即dev.env.js和prod.env.js,我们直接复制生产环境.原创 2020-06-23 14:50:54 · 580 阅读 · 0 评论 -
Vuex的使用
初始化vue项目 安装Vuex npm install vuex --save 初始化Vuex 在项目根目录下的src目录下创建vuex文件夹,用于存放vuex相关文件,并新建index.js用于编写相关代码 创建Vuex实例,并向外暴露 import Vue from 'vue' import Vuex from 'vuex' Vue.use(Vuex) const store =...原创 2020-02-17 16:58:28 · 648 阅读 · 0 评论 -
在Vue项目中使用WebUploader实现文件上传
简介: WebUploader是由Baidu WebFE(FEX)团队开发的一个简单的以HTML5为主,FLASH为辅的现代文件上传组件。在现代的浏览器里面能充分发挥HTML5的优势,同时又不摒弃主流IE浏览器,沿用原来的FLASH运行时,兼容IE6+,iOS 6+, android 4+。两套运行时,同样的调用方式,可供用户任意选用。采用大文件分片并发上传,极大的提高了文件上传效率。 分片...原创 2019-07-21 17:24:59 · 7405 阅读 · 3 评论 -
vue项目中使用axios封装请求
新建单独文件夹和文件存放封装代码 在vue项目文件夹下的src目录内,新建request文件夹,创建http.js和api.js文件 http.js http.js主要是配置axios、设置拦截器、封装请求等 ...原创 2019-09-01 14:56:58 · 154 阅读 · 0 评论 -
使用Vue脚手架构建项目时Runtime + Compiler和Runtime-only的区别
在使用vue-cli脚手架构建项目时,会遇到一个选项Vue build(vue构建),有两个选项,Runtime + Compiler和Runtime-only,以下为有道翻译直译 Runtime + Compiler: recommended for most users 运行时+编译器:推荐给大多数用户–有道翻译 Runtime-only: about 6KB lighter min+g...原创 2019-09-01 17:18:48 · 934 阅读 · 0 评论 -
vue-cli2与vue-cli3在一台电脑共存
1、新建两个文件夹,分别用于存放vue-cli2和vue-cli3 2、进入vue2文件夹下载安装vue-cli2.0 vue-cli2.0版本下载命令为npm install vue-cli或者npm install vue-cli@版本号,这里我指定了版本号,还有这里不要加-g,否则就会安装到全局位置 检验 下载完毕,会生成一个node_modules文件夹,进入该文件夹下的.bi...原创 2019-09-25 10:49:44 · 1565 阅读 · 0 评论